Guarantee
This instrument is guaranteed for a period of 12 months since the date
of shipment. Under warranty, any fault which is not caused by improper
use will be repaired for free.
Liability of the user: Use this instrument according to this instruction
manual. When this instrument needs to be repaired, please send it back
to our company or our appointed repair centers.
The guarantee is limited only to the instrument, and does not involve
any damage of equipment, personnel and property caused by improper
use of the instrument.

II
Limitation of Guarentee
The warranty is not applicable for the faults resulted by improper use or
inadequate maintenance (including software and interfaces), and
unauthorized open of the instrument. Within the 12 months warranty
period, calibration, maintenance service and consultation shall be free.
After the 12 months warranty period, fees for material and repair will be
charged reasonabliy.
The following items are not under warranty:
A. Damages caused by improper voltage input.
B. Deformation or damage of panel, switches, devices and case as
well as defects involving interval parts caused by external
mechanical force (shocking, dropping, and etc.).
C. Defects caused by unauthorized repair.
D. Defects caused by the instrument worked beyond the required
technology specification.
